Because Astra is a University system it does not reserve space during any of the breaks (fall, spring, holiday) and since UCL does schedule classes during the breaks it is necessary to reserve your space directly in Astra.

 

To ensure your space is reserved during semester breaks

  1. Login to Tableau

  2. Navigate to Scheduling Reports (Explore> Scheduling> Room Report for Fall-Spring Break)

  3. Select Room Report

       

  4.   Filter Data as needed to show classes your Unit has scheduled in CLSS/PS. Any space reflected on this audit will then need to be added manually to Astra.

  5. Reserve your team's space needs in Astra as a Special Event. Reference material is available in the UCL Astra Canvas Course.

What should I do if I've reserved space in Astra for a class that has canceled?

If your class needs to be canceled regular protocol should be followed by submitting a task to the UCL Service Desk (uclsupport@utah.edu) with the class cancellation (term, subject, catalog number, and section) information. Then you will need to login to Astra and cancel the Special Event reservation. See the UCL Canvas Course for instructions on Changing or Deleting an Astra Reservation.
